Grammar usage guide and real-world examples

US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"be gathered through the"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ing the process of collecting or assembling information, data, or resources from various sources. Example: "The data for the report will be gathered through the survey responses collected from participants."

Expert writing Tips

Best practice

When using "be gathered through the", ensure the sentence clearly identifies both the source and the method of collection. This clarifies how the information or data was obtained, adding credibility to your writing.

Common error

Avoid using "be gathered through the" without specifying the exact source or method. For instance, instead of writing 'Data was gathered through the internet,' be specific: 'Data was gathered through online surveys and publicly available government databases'.

FAQs

How can I rephrase "be gathered through the" to sound more formal?

For a more formal tone, you can use phrases like "be acquired by means of" or "be obtained via". These options often suit academic or professional contexts.

What are some alternatives to "be gathered through the" in scientific writing?

In scientific writing, consider using "be derived from", "be extracted from", or "be compiled from". These phrases highlight the analytical or systematic nature of the data collection process.

Is it always necessary to specify the method when saying data "be gathered through the"?

While not always mandatory, specifying the method enhances clarity and credibility. Including the method (e.g., "be gathered through the survey") provides readers with a better understanding of how the information was obtained.

What is the difference between saying something "be gathered through the" versus "stem from"?

While "be gathered through the" indicates a collection process, "stem from" indicates origin or causation. Using "be gathered through the" implies a deliberate effort to collect information, whereas "stem from" suggests that something originates or results from a particular source or cause.
